Job Description

Position: Emergency Intern

Job Time: Full-Time

Job Type: Internship

Place of Work: Hawassa, Ethiopia

Salary: Birr 6,500.00

Application Deadline: April, 19/2023 

PIN would like to invite an energetic, disciplined, responsible female intern applicant to work under Emergency Program.

Length of internship: for 6 months

Number required: 1 (one)

The Interns will assist the emergency program manager to coordinate numerous programs across all project implementation locations. The Intern will support handling difficult onsite situations as they arise. The Intern will work effectively as a member of a team, be able to provide direction and leadership, delegate, and possess strong organizational skills.

As a Program Manager intern, the Intern will collaborate and partner with the emergency team to define and solve problems that impact beneficiaries, and project activities, as well as identify predictors and causes of project-related problems to implement different approaches related to anticipating and prediction. The Intern will identify, develop, manage, and execute analyses to uncover areas of opportunity and present written project recommendations.
